Kia EV2: Opening and closing / Bonnet

Kia EV2 (QV1, 2026-2026) Owner's Manual / Opening and closing / Bonnet

The bonnet acts as a secure protective cover for the motor and front electrical compartments of your Kia EV2.

Open the bonnet whenever routine maintenance work needs to be performed in the motor room or when you need to inspect internal fluid reservoirs and components.

Opening the bonnet

  1. Pull the interior primary release lever (1) located near the footwell to unlatch the bonnet mechanism. The bonnet will pop open slightly with an audible click.

    Kia EV2 interior primary bonnet release lever location in the driver footwell
  2. Walk to the front of the vehicle, raise the bonnet slightly, reach under the center front edge to push the secondary safety release lever, and lift the panel fully.

    Kia EV2 exterior secondary safety latch release lever under the bonnet edge
  3. Lift the bonnet upward. Integrated gas struts will take over and smoothly raise it to the fully open position automatically after it passes the halfway point.

Bonnet open warning

A dedicated security warning message appears clearly on the digital instrument cluster display whenever the bonnet is left unlatched or open.

Kia EV2 digital instrument cluster showing the open bonnet warning notification

The visual warning reminder remains active on the LCD display until the bonnet is firmly closed and latched.

An audible warning chime will also sound if you attempt to drive the vehicle while the bonnet is improperly secured.

Closing the bonnet

Kia EV2 bonnet latch mechanism viewed prior to closing
  1. Before closing the bonnet of your Kia EV2, perform a quick final inspection to ensure the following conditions are met:

    • All fluid reservoir filler caps in the motor compartment must be securely and correctly installed.

    • Any maintenance gloves, shop rags, tools, or combustible materials must be completely removed from the motor room.

  2. Lower the bonnet until it is about halfway down, then press downward firmly to engage the primary and secondary latches securely in place.

  3. Verify that the bonnet has latched completely. If you find the panel can still be lifted slightly, it means the lock is not fully engaged; open it again and re-close it using slightly more downward force.

CAUTION

Bonnet obstruction

Always verify that all foreign objects and physical obstructions are cleared from the latch area before closing the bonnet. Slamming the hood down over an obstruction can cause severe structural damage to your vehicle or personal injury.

WARNING

Fire risk

Never leave wiping rags, protective gloves, or other flammable materials inside the motor compartment, as retained engine bay heat can easily ignite them.

Unsecured bonnet

Always double-check to ensure the bonnet is firmly and completely latched before driving off. An unsecured bonnet can fly open unexpectedly while the Kia EV2 is in motion, completely obscuring the driver's forward visibility and causing a dangerous accident.
